我们正在使用Jenkins 2.16,电子邮件扩展插件2.47和状态监视器插件来检查我们的网站以确保它已启动。目标是向我们的手机发送电子邮件,提醒我们检查失败。
一切正常,但没有人得到文本!
发送到name@ourcompany.com的电子邮件工作。电子邮件发送到@ gmail.com工作!发往1234567899@tmomail.net的电子邮件不起作用。我在该服务器上有一个powershell,它发送电子邮件到1234567899@tmomail.net,我收到了一个文本。
我尝试过短信Jenkins插件,但它需要付费会员资格而我公司不同意。
我接下来会尝试一个hack,其中Jenkins称PS1使用Powershell插件运行......但这完全是愚蠢和难以管理。无法管理Jenkins前端。
是什么给出的?!?关于如何让JUST Jenkins工作的任何想法? 我看到控制台输出没有错误:https://i.stack.imgur.com/1AT9M.png
这个问题类似于 Integrating SMS service in Jenkins ......但没有人回答。
答案 0 :(得分:0)
问题解决了。
我的全局设置中有一个Jenkins管理地址的电子邮件地址是虚假的(no@reply.com)。我将其更改为合法的公司电子邮件,现在正在发送文本。
我通过在Jenkins论坛上发布一个错误来获得此解决方案,他们在那里给了我一些可能的解决方案。